Understanding the Game Structure

Pokerstars offers a diverse selection of game formats, catering to the varied preferences of its player base. These include cash games, Sit & Go tournaments, and multi-table tournaments, each providing unique opportunities and challenges. Cash games function as open-ended poker rounds where players can join and leave at their discretion, while tournaments require participants to compete until a winner is crowned based on their chip count.

Rules of Engagement

The fundamental rules of poker apply across the myriad game formats available on Pokerstars. Whether participating in Texas Hold'em or Omaha, players must form the best possible hand using a combination of their hole cards and community cards. Betting rounds determine the flow of the game, with strategic plays and calculated risks proving pivotal in securing victory.

Beyond these basics, Pokerstars introduces unique rules in certain tournament formats to heighten the excitement and challenge. For instance, knockout tournaments reward players for eliminating opponents, while turbo and hyper-turbo tournaments feature accelerated blind structures, pressuring participants to adopt aggressive strategies.
